Applications are now open for BC CATCH

Created by the Beaver County Chamber of Commerce in partnership with Butler Agnew & Associates, this new program helps local small businesses and nonprofits strengthen their financial systems through expert guidance, practical training, and personalized support.

Approved participants receive:

  • A personalized accounting software assessment and needs analysis
  • Customized accounting procedures and a monthly close checklist
  • Hands-on training and question-and-answer office hours
  • A best-practices guide tailored to their accounting system
  • Follow-up guidance and support for 60 days after training

A $1,500 VALUE—FULLY SUBSIDIZED

Thanks to pilot funding, BC CATCH is available at no cost to approved participants during the pilot period.

WHO CAN APPLY?

Eligible applicants must be located in Beaver County, have annual revenue under $5 million, and be prepared to commit staff time to the discovery, implementation, and training process. Both for-profit businesses and nonprofit organizations are encouraged to apply.

QuickBooks Online is the program’s primary platform, but organizations using other accounting systems are also welcome to apply.

Enrollment is limited, and applications will be considered on a first-come, first-served basis as capacity becomes available.

Aligned Data Centers Purchases 650 Acre Shippingport Site for Over $223M

Aligned Data Centers has purchased the 650 Acre Shippingport Industrial Park for over $223 million. The plan outlines three data center buildings to be built and operated out of the site. Aligned has built over 50 data centers across the Americas, with regional locations in Sandusky, Ohio and Frederick, Maryland. Aligned is dedicated to operating data centers on a closed-loop system, designed to reduce impacts on the surrounding communities. Read more about the land purchase and building plans here (A subscription may be required).

Small Commercial Rebates Program

Columbia Gas of Pennsylvania is pleased to offer the Small Commercial Rebates Program, which provides financial incentives to eligible small business customers who upgrade existing natural gas equipment with more energy-efficient models.

Eligible businesses who choose to upgrade through this program may receive rebates when replacing older, less efficient natural gas equipment on a one-for-one basis with qualifying high-efficiency equipment. The goal is to help businesses lower energy consumption, lower costs, and invest in long-term savings.

To qualify for this program, businesses must be Columbia Gas of Pennsylvania small commercial customers who pay the Energy Efficiency (EE) Rider on their utility bill. Interested customers can submit their rebate applications online alongside supporting documentation. Acceptable documents include invoices and equipment information. Notice of Public Hearing – Beaver County

Transit Authority

 

The Beaver County Transit Authority will hold a public hearing on Monday, August 10, 2026, at 4:00 pm to receive public comments regarding proposed service changes to BCTA’s “Connect” service. Service changes and fare changes, which if approved, would take place Tuesday, September 8, 2026. The hearing will be held in the Board Room of the BCTA Transportation Center, located at 200 West Washington Street, Rochester, PA 15074.

Written comments regarding the proposed changes will be accepted until 12:00 pm on Monday, August 10, 2026, to be included in the public hearing. All written comments should be emailed to customerservice@bcta.com, mailed or delivered in person to BCTA, 200 West Washington Street, Rochester, PA 15074.

Proposed “Connect” Service Changes

  • Add Saturday “Connect” service between the hours of 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M
  • Add In-County “Connect” service as a feeder into BCTA’s Fixed Route System at Park & Ride locations
  • Add Out-of-County “Connect” service zone to include portions of Robinson Town Center and North Fayette
  • New fare structure range of $4.00 – $7.00 based on mileage
